Crag: Mowing Word

The Darkness Beckons

Date of ascent: 27/08/2017
Length/grade/stars: 30m HVS 5a *
Climbers: Jules Lane, Andy Hardy

Start location:

Start at a steep blocky corner forming an arete approximately 20m left of The Beak (looking in).

Pitch descriptions:

Climb the corner to large ledges on the arête. Go left and follow the break all the way around the bay. This is easy to start with and gets progressively more tricky. The last section is awkward, with high footholds leading to a good ledge which is the half way belay for The Curver. Handholds are excellent throughout but gear is hard to place with lots of large cams your best bet. Finish by climbing out on The Curver, Nijinsky or Cormorant Flake.

Additional info:

Line of the route could no doubt be continued across the corner of Cormorant Flake, eventually joining Heart of Darkness.
